Editing Tabs

Resources:A strip of paper and glue. What to do: When students have completed a piece of work, get them to do their usual corrections- i.e SPaG. However, when giving them this DIRT time, get them to re-write their paragraph/text/work on a separate piece of paper and then stick it partially over their work.This way they can see their improvements and so can the teacher/parents/carers! Variations: Peer improvements?
